What Is the Aetna Vital Dental Savings Plan?
The aetna vital dental savings plan is not a traditional insurance policy. Instead, it is a dental discount program that gives members access to a network of dentists who have agreed to provide services at reduced fees. This means that when you go for cleanings, exams, fillings, or even major procedures like crowns or root canals, you pay a discounted rate rather than the full price. 🧾
Unlike standard dental insurance, which typically comes with deductibles, annual maximums, waiting periods, and claim processing, aetna vital dental savings offers immediate access to savings. You simply present your membership card at a participating provider and pay the reduced fee at the time of service — no paperwork, no hassle!

Aetna vs Traditional Dental Insurance: Key Differences
When deciding between aetna vital dental savings and traditional dental insurance, it’s essential to understand how they differ in structure, cost, flexibility, and coverage. While both aim to make dental care more affordable, the way they operate can dramatically affect your experience — and your wallet. Let’s break down the critical differences so you can choose what fits your lifestyle best. 🧠💸
1. Cost Structure
Traditional dental insurance usually involves a monthly premium, which can range from $30 to $70 per person. In contrast, aetna vital dental savings is a one-time annual fee — approximately $130 for individuals and $190 for families. That means you’re not locked into a monthly commitment and only pay once per year. 💳
| Feature | Traditional Dental Insurance | Aetna Vital Dental Savings |
|---|---|---|
| Monthly Premium | $30–$70/month | $0 (One-time annual fee) |
| Deductibles | Yes (typically $50–$150) | No |
| Annual Maximums | $1,000–$1,500/year | Unlimited use |
2. Waiting Periods
Most dental insurance plans have waiting periods for major services — often between 6 and 12 months. That’s a long time to wait for something like a crown or root canal. With aetna vital dental savings, there are no waiting periods. You can start saving immediately upon enrollment. ⏱️
3. Paperwork and Claims
Insurance requires billing codes, claims processing, and sometimes even reimbursement delays. It can be a hassle to get your procedure covered or approved. The aetna vital dental savings model eliminates this step. Just show your card, pay the discounted rate, and you’re done — no claims, no denials, no delays. 🧾✅
